At a Glance
- Tasks: Develop cutting-edge embedded software for radar technology using Linux and C/C++.
- Company: Join a forward-thinking tech company at the forefront of innovation.
- Benefits: Generous salary up to £45K, hybrid working, and great benefits.
- Why this job: Be part of a dynamic team shaping the future of radar technology.
- Qualifications: 2-4 years in Embedded C/C++ development and strong Linux skills required.
- Other info: Exciting opportunities for growth and learning in a collaborative environment.
The predicted salary is between 32400 - 54000 £ per year.
An Embedded Software Engineer with 2-4 years’ commercial low level C/C++ software development experience using Embedded Linux will get involved with the very latest radar technology development. A generous salary will be offered up to c£45K with Hybrid working and good benefits.
Applicants for this Embedded Software Engineer position must possess strong Linux skills – ideally with experience of some low level setup/configuration of Embedded Linux systems (such as uboot or device tree) and/or using Linux Build Systems (such as Petalinux or Yocto).
As a key member of a cross functional team, you will bring good problem solving skills, a good academic background and an interest in new technology developments.
Applications are welcomed from Software Engineers with both C and C++ skills or with expertise in one with the confidence to learn the other. Development under Linux is essential.
Embedded Software Engineer requirements include:
- University education in relevant Engineering discipline.
- Minimum of 2-4 years commercial Embedded C/C++ Development in Linux.
- Low level setup/configuration of Embedded Linux systems.
- Linux Build Systems such as Yocto.
- Knowledge of Networking and Protocols.
- Some Python.
Embedded Software Engineer (Linux/Yocto) employer: Technical Futures Ltd
Contact Detail:
Technical Futures Ltd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Embedded Software Engineer (Linux/Yocto)
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ech world, especially those who work with Embedded Linux. A friendly chat can lead to insider info about job openings that aren't even advertised yet.
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those involving C/C++ and Linux.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for interviews by brushing up on your problem-solving skills. Expect technical questions related to low-level setup/configuration of Embedded Linux systems. Practising common interview scenarios can help you feel more confident.
✨Tip Number 4
Don't forget to apply through our website! We make it easy for you to find the right role. Plus, it shows you're genuinely interested in joining our team. So, get your application in and let’s get you started on this exciting journey!
We think you need these skills to ace Embedded Software Engineer (Linux/Yocto)
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Embedded Linux and C/C++ development. We want to see how your skills match the job description, so don’t be shy about showcasing relevant projects or roles you've had!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you’re passionate about embedded systems and how your background makes you a great fit for our team. Let us know what excites you about working with radar technology!
Show Off Your Problem-Solving Skills: In your application, give examples of how you've tackled challenges in your previous roles. We love seeing candidates who can think critically and come up with innovative solutions, especially in low-level software development.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ates from our team. Plus, we love seeing applications come in through our own platform!
How to prepare for a job interview at Technical Futures Ltd
✨Know Your Linux Inside Out
Make sure you brush up on your Linux skills before the interview. Be prepared to discuss low-level setup and configuration of Embedded Linux systems, like uboot or device tree. They’ll likely ask you about your experience with Linux Build Systems such as Yocto, so having specific examples ready will really help you stand out.
✨Show Off Your C/C++ Skills
Since they’re looking for someone with solid C/C++ development experience, be ready to talk about your projects. Bring examples of your work that demonstrate your coding abilities and problem-solving skills. If you’ve worked on any relevant radar technology or similar projects, make sure to highlight those!
✨Be a Team Player
As a key member of a cross-functional team, it’s important to show that you can collaborate effectively. Prepare to discuss how you’ve worked with others in the past, especially in challenging situations. Highlight your communication skills and how you contribute to team success.
✨Stay Curious About New Technologies
They’re looking for someone who has an interest in new technology developments. Be prepared to share what you’re currently learning or exploring in the tech world. This shows your passion for the field and your willingness to grow, which is something every employer loves to see!